Avatar billede Lystfisker Seniormester
11. september 2018 - 20:53 Der er 3 kommentarer og
1 løsning

Beregning af tid

Hvordan beregner jeg en delsum af tid.
Jeg vil lave en formel der kan beregne hvor mange timer der bruges ud fra to løn tariffer

Der er en timepris fra 06:00 til 17:00 og en anden timepris fra 17:00 til 06:00.
Jeg skriver arbejdstidsstart i celle D5 og arbejdstids ophør i Celle E5

Fx. starter en medarbejder kl. 10:00 og slutter kl. 22:00. I celle G5 vil jeg gerne have beregnet tiden fra 10:00 -17:00 og i Celle H5 vil jeg gerne have beregnet tiden fra 17:00 - 22:00.

Pft. Lystfiskeren :-)
Avatar billede Jan Hansen Ekspert
11. september 2018 - 22:50 #1
Hej

G5: =HVIS(TIDSVÆRDI("17:00")<E5;TIDSVÆRDI("17:00");E5)-HVIS(TIDSVÆRDI("6:00")>D5;TIDSVÆRDI("6:00");D5)
H5: =HVIS(TIDSVÆRDI("6:00")>D5;TIDSVÆRDI("6:00")-D5;0)+HVIS(TIDSVÆRDI("17:00")<E5;E5-TIDSVÆRDI("17:00");0)

Virker ikke ved start efter 17 så skal der laves nogle flere betingelser, men nu har du princippet.

Jan
Avatar billede falster Ekspert
11. september 2018 - 23:00 #2
Jan viser udmærket ovenfor, hvorledes der skal konstrueres ganske komplekse hvis-funktioner ved traditionel Excel-anvendelse.

Hvis-funktionerne kan blive lidt kortere, hvis du anvender f.eks. cellerne A1:B2 til de 4 grænser og navngiver dem f.eks. St_1, Sl_1, St_2 og Sl_2. Alle celler formateres til klokkeslæt.

(Jeg vil  i øvrigt anbefale at anvende Access.)
Avatar billede jens48 Ekspert
11. september 2018 - 23:16 #3
Prøv med denne formel i G5:

=(D5>=6/24)*(D5<=17/24)*(E5<=17/24)*(E5-D5)+(D5>=6/24)*(D5<=17/24)*(E5>=17/24)*(17/24-D5)+(D5<6/24)*(D5<=17/24)*(E5>=17/24)*(17/24-6/24)+(D5<6/24)*(D5<=17/24)*(E5<17/24)*(E5-6/24)

og i H5:
=(6/24>=$D$5)*(6/24-$D$5)+(17/24<=$E$5)*($E$5-17/24)+($D$5>17/24)*($E$5<$D$5)*(1-$D$5)+($D$5>17/24)*($E$5<$D$5)*($E$5<6/24)*$E$5
Avatar billede Lystfisker Seniormester
20. september 2018 - 14:29 #4
Tak til Jens48

Det er den løsning som jeg bedst forstår :-)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el-k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ester